Psalms 144

1Blessed be Jehovah my rock, Who teacheth my hands to war, Andmy fingers to fight:

2My lovingkindness, and my fortress, My high tower, and my deliverer; My shield, and he in whom I take refuge; Who subdueth my people under me.

3Jehovah, what is man, that thou takest knowledge of him? Or the son of man, that thou makest account of him?

4Man is like to vanity: His days are as a shadow that passeth away.

5Bow thy heavens, O Jehovah, and come down: Touch the mountains, and they shall smoke.

6Cast forth lightning, and scatter them; Send out thine arrows, and discomfit them.

7Stretch forth thy hand from above; Rescue me, and deliver me out of great waters, Out of the hand of aliens;

8Whose mouth speaketh deceit, And whose right hand is a right hand of falsehood.

9I will sing a new song unto thee, O God: Upon a psaltery of ten strings will I sing praises unto thee.

10Thou art he that giveth salvation unto kings; Who rescueth David his servant from the hurtful sword.

11Rescue me, and deliver me out of the hand of aliens, Whose mouth speaketh deceit, And whose right hand is a right hand of falsehood.

12When our sons shall be as plants grown up in their youth, And our daughters as corner-stones hewn after the fashion of a palace;

13Whenour garners are full, affording all manner of store, Andour sheep bring forth thousands and ten thousands in our fields;

14Whenour oxen are well laden; When there isno breaking in, and no going forth, And no outcry in our streets:

15Happy is the people that is in such a case; Yea, happy is the people whose God is Jehovah.

Psalms 144

1Blessed be the LORD, my Rock, who trains my hands for war, my fingers for battle.

2He is my steadfast love and my fortress, my stronghold and my deliverer. He is my shield, in whom I take refuge, who subdues peoples under me.

3O LORD, what is man, that You regard him, the son of man that You think of him?

4Man is like a breath; his days are like a passing shadow.

5Part Your heavens, O LORD, and come down; touch the mountains, that they may smoke.

6Flash forth Your lightning and scatter them; shoot Your arrows and rout them.

7Reach down from on high; set me free and rescue me from the deep waters, from the grasp of foreigners,

8whose mouths speak falsehood, whose right hands are deceitful.

9I will sing to You a new song, O God; on a harp of ten strings I will make music to You—

10to Him who gives victory to kings, who frees His servant David from the deadly sword.

11Set me free and rescue me from the grasp of foreigners, whose mouths speak falsehood, whose right hands are deceitful.

12Then our sons will be like plants nurtured in their youth, our daughters like corner pillars carved to adorn a palace.

13Our storehouses will be full, supplying all manner of produce; our flocks will bring forth thousands, tens of thousands in our fields.

14Our oxen will bear great loads. There will be no breach in the walls, no going into captivity, and no cry of lament in our streets.

15Blessed are the people of whom this is so; blessed are the people whose God is the LORD.

Understanding American Standard Version vs Berean Study Bible in Psalms 144

American Standard Version (ASV)

A highly literal translation known for accuracy and adherence to the original Hebrew and Greek. Consistent word choices make it excellent for careful study and cross-referencing. A strong pick for readers who want a precise, classic-modern English Bible.

Berean Study Bible (BSB)

A modern translation balancing readability with faithfulness to the original texts. Written in clear, contemporary English for both reading and study. A strong all-around choice for daily use.
